How can your home be a place of peace and joy? How can you set your children up for academic success? What curriculum should you purchase? Let The Seven R's of Homeschooling help you 'major on the majors' and 'minor on the minors' by showing you where to focus your attention in teaching your children. This book will equip you to foster healthy relationships, instill godly values, and produce fluent readers who communicate clearly, think soundly, and know where to get the information they need.
You've heard of the three R's. Now, let's explore the seven R's and their practical application for educating your children at home. The Seven R's are Reading, wRiting, aRithemetic, Research, Rhetoric, Relationships, & Right Living
Whether your homeschooling journey has just begun or you are a veteran homeschool parent, this book will challenge and inspire you! With glimpses into a real family where homeschooling works, Meredith shares practical ideas that you can implement in your own home. Let an older mom pass on some experienced wisdom to you.
